146- ### ElixirLS
129+ ## ElixirLS
147130
148- #### Automatic Installation
131+ ### Automatic Installation
149132
150133When a compatible installation of ELixirLS is not found, you will be prompted to install it. The plugin will download the source code to the ` .elixir_ls ` directory and compile it using the Elixir and OTP versions used by your current project.
151134
@@ -155,68 +138,68 @@ Caveat: This currently downloads the language server into the `.elixir_ls` direc
155138
156139![ auto-install-elixirls] ( https://user-images.githubusercontent.com/5523984/160333851-94d448d9-5c80-458c-aa0d-4c81528dde8f.gif )
157140
158- #### Root Path Detection
141+ ### Root Path Detection
159142
160143` elixir-tools.nvim ` should be able to properly set the root directory for umbrella and non-umbrella apps. The nvim-lspconfig project's root detection doesn't properly account for umbrella projects.
161144
162- #### Run Tests
145+ ### Run Tests
163146
164147ElixirLS provides a codelens to identify and run your tests. If you configure ` enableTestLenses = true ` in the settings table, you will see the codelens as virtual text in your editor and can run them with ` vim.lsp.codelens.run() ` .
